Mini-courses are seen as a way to broaden exploration and participation of students outside of the over-burdened, over-pressured semesters, and increase engagement and depth of focus. Three mini-courses are planned targeting architects and planners. They link: 1) further development and testing of innovative 'tools and strategies' for designers; 2) direct community involvement through field workshops; and 3) reflection on practice in a learn-do-reflect/brainstorm cycle. Instead of seeking funding for a single course, a series following a single theme is proposed, addressing a broader range of related issues.
